We are very excited to be part of the DfE Opening Schools' Facilities project which will enable us to run more after school sports clubs next year. It has also provided us with additional equipment including three table tennis tables, archery sets and boxercise equipment. We have been awarded a Go Parks commission which will enable us to run inclusive tennis sessions at Spencer Park. We have also been asked by the LTA to run a city-wide deaf tennis festival in Deaf Awareness Week in May. |

We were delighted to be invited by the British Museum to help them develop a new national learning programme based on a virtual reality quest. Pupils in Year 4 were able to give feedback to the British Museum's education manager on the materials and they have given some valuable input into the design of the programme. We have been invited to test the proto type later in the year |
